WebApr 3, 2024 · Oxycontin, Rixicodone, Xtampza ER, and Percocet ( oxycodone) are used for moderate to severe acute and chronic pain. It can come in a liquid, tablets, or capsules. Morphine is administered for both short-term and chronic pain. Its potency is similar to that of oxycodone, and it can be swallowed or injected. WebMay 20, 2024 · Active ingredients in over-the-counter topical pain medications can include: Capsaicin. Capsaicin (kap-SAY-ih-sin) causes the burning sensation you associate with chili peppers. Capsaicin creams deplete your nerve cells of a chemical that's important for sending pain messages. Examples include Capzasin and Zostrix. oxford owner
